Homepage
Open in app
Sign in
Get started
Pipedrive R&D Blog
Stories from Pipedrive’s product, engineering, design, marketing, localization, and many other teams
Engineering
Product Management
DevOps
Mentorship
Developer Platform
Pipedrive Careers
Follow
Improve Software Quality: Proven Steps That Helped Us Boost Quality
Improve Software Quality: Proven Steps That Helped Us Boost Quality
56% fewer production bugs, 62% fewer P1/P2 incidents, and a 49% drop in defect injection rate
Robert Krikk
Jun 3
A Practical Guide to Indexing JSON in MySQL
A Practical Guide to Indexing JSON in MySQL
Functional Indexes vs. Generated STORED Columns — Performance, Practicality, and Pitfalls
Haldun Uraz BORALILAR
May 14
Writing code, braving cold: How discipline powers Pavlo’s ML journey at Pipedrive
Writing code, braving cold: How discipline powers Pavlo’s ML journey at Pipedrive
Writing code by day, braving cold by morning — meet Pavlo Pyvovar who brings discipline and curiosity to everything he does at Pipedrive.
Maie-Liisa Sildnik
May 7
Code, community and cold plunges: Meet Markus, the software engineer building culture at Pipedrive
Code, community and cold plunges: Meet Markus, the software engineer building culture at Pipedrive
DevOps by day, sauna master by night — meet Markus, the engineer bringing energy and heart to Pipedrive.
Maie-Liisa Sildnik
Apr 15
How Pipedrive optimised the long-term storage of metrics with Grafana Mimir
How Pipedrive optimised the long-term storage of metrics with Grafana Mimir
Implementing a user-friendly solution to store, monitor and visualise metric trends over the years
Robert Salong
Apr 9
Customer Obsession Starts from Within
Customer Obsession Starts from Within
At Pipedrive, we talk a lot about customer obsession — and for good reason. Hear how we’re celebrating customers through Comms and Events…
Caroline Rheubottom
Apr 1
Think Like a Scientist, Build Like a Leader
Think Like a Scientist, Build Like a Leader
A mindset shift for building better products, faster
Almonzer Eskandar
Mar 25
Cache poisoning prevention in Node.js
Cache poisoning prevention in Node.js
Block malicious attacks and keep performance high — discover safe, efficient ways to stay in control. Strengthen your defenses now.
Nelson Gomes
Feb 18
Database Engineering in Pipedrive: An Overview
Database Engineering in Pipedrive: An Overview
Let’s talk about Pipedrive databases: the architecture, infrastructure, orchestration and what awaits Database Engineering in the future.
Max Goldenberg
Feb 4
Optimizing Data Archiving Strategies: A Comprehensive Guide to Smarter Database Management
Optimizing Data Archiving Strategies: A Comprehensive Guide to Smarter Database Management
Exploring Three Proven Methods for Efficient Data Archiving
Haldun Uraz BORALILAR
Jan 21
Continuous Localization at Pipedrive
Continuous Localization at Pipedrive
“The first thing you need to do, the one thing you absolutely must do, is tell your developers to deploy less.”
David Edwards
Jan 7
How to reduce latency spikes: a trick with shared upstream requests
How to reduce latency spikes: a trick with shared upstream requests
How an investigation into SLI fluctuations has led to a small yet significant improvement in our API gateway L2 cache
Max Goldenberg
Nov 27, 2024
Performance Monitoring and Response Improvement for Multi-Schema Databases in MySQL
Performance Monitoring and Response Improvement for Multi-Schema Databases in MySQL
Managing databases in modern infrastructure environments is a challenging task; this is how we did it with multi-schema setup…
Haldun Uraz BORALILAR
Oct 22, 2024
From manual to magical: Automating API docs and code autocomplete with TypeScript and OpenAPI
From manual to magical: Automating API docs and code autocomplete with TypeScript and OpenAPI
Creating and maintaining API docs is not easy. What if you could automate it so your docs are up-to-date without any manual work?
Luis Henriques
Jul 30, 2024
How being an impatient person led me to content design
How being an impatient person led me to content design
How impatience has helped me realize my new passion for product and user experience.
Yael Ilani
Jul 15, 2024
Navigating Kubernetes Complexity (Part II)
Navigating Kubernetes Complexity (Part II)
Challenges faced in managing Kubernetes clusters, offering practical solutions and expert insights.
Nelson Gomes
Jun 25, 2024
About Pipedrive R&D Blog
Latest Stories
Archive
About Medium
Terms
Privacy
Teams